I know it's already been confirmed that David Yates will direct the 6th movie, but who would you have wanted to direct this one?
Yates directed OotP and will direct HBP.
Columbus directed SS and CoS.
Cuaron directed PoA.
Make your choice! I chose Columbus, because he did an excellent jop interpreting the books into movies, filling the audience in on every important detail. |
